HARNESS ROOFING, INC.

Fall through surface or existing opening 16 to 20 feet · Fractures and other injuries, n.e.c.

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at HARNESS ROOFING, INC., 2015 W University, SILOAM SPRINGS, ARKANSAS 72761 on , Fractures and other injuries, n.e.c., affecting the multiple body parts, n.e.c..

An employee was removing insulation from the sheetrock ceiling of a roof when he stepped on the sheetrock ceiling and fell 20 feet to the floor below. He suffered a fractured skull, broken ribs, lacerated spleen, broken left wrist, and bruised kidney.
